Helyn Simo N Boyajian 1925 - 2003

Helyn Simo N Boyajian of Fort Lauderdale, Broward County, FL was born on August 20, 1925, and died at age 77 years old on February 27, 2003.

In 1925, in the year that Helyn Simo N Boyajian was born, on November 28th, radio station WSM broadcast the Grand Ole Opry for the first time. Originally airing as “The WSM Barn Dance”, the Opry (a local term for "opera") was dedicated to honoring country music and in its history has featured the biggest stars and acts in country music.

In 1931, Helyn Simo was only 6 years old when in March, “The Star Spangled Banner” officially became the national anthem by congressional resolution. Other songs had previously been used - among them, "My Country, 'Tis of Thee", "God Bless America", and "America the Beautiful". There was fierce debate about making "The Star Spangled Banner" the national anthem - Southerners and veterans organizations supported it, pacifists and educators opposed it.
